NZME rebuffs Adshel NZ buyout; makes new merger overtures

EditorNews Make a Comment

NZME has turned down an option to buy the New Zealand arm of Australasian bus shelter advertising business Adshel. Patrick Smellie, writing in NBR Online, reported that NZME also confirmed it has made a new joint submission to the Commerce Commission with Fairfax NZ, arguing again the case for the proposed merger between the two news publishers, which the commission has […]
